Output e66296461d1ebb13eb99315e21dc01b75df7e614cfda1ecac9758c22c82eac61:1

value
341300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fd2c514e17d83e4f866ea6e258e095be14f2152 OP_EQUALVERIFY OP_CHECKSIG
address
LN8Dhht6aweckBFtqcgZt8mRiS4BJY2CE9
transaction
e66296461d1ebb13eb99315e21dc01b75df7e614cfda1ecac9758c22c82eac61
spent
true